Fields of Application and Conveyed FluidsDepending on customer requirements, our single stage close-coupled pumps are used in many applications: They can be used for cooling technology, energy technology, industrial cleaning technology, water and wastewater technology as well as in the chemical industry. The pumps are particularly suitable for the supply of pure or slightly contaminated liquids.Variants of the Single Stage EDUR-Close-Coupled PumpEDUR offers high-quality single stage close-coupled pumps with our NUB, CB and BC series. The pumps are available in a variety of construction styles and materials (e.g. grey cast iron, spheroidal graphite iron, bronze or stainless steel) as well as with various shaft seal systems and drive solutions. Of course, we also provide certificates of all authorized classification societies and necessary test reports.AdvantagesEDUR-single stage close-coupled pumps stand out due to their efficient, economic, reliable, and long-lasting performance. Additional product advantages as well as technical characteristics are outlined below: Axial thrust-free, open or load-relieved, closed impellers Compensation of radial forces due to diffuser elements in the ring housing Low NPSH values Possibility to convey gas-loaded liquids Excellent control behavior Robustness against certain amounts of solid contents Optimized size of pressure nozzle for low pipe friction losses and velocity head difference Protection against dry running Application in vacuum operation Low-pulsation transport of media Optional sensor-based operation monitoring Low noise emissions Various installation positions Easy installation Field of application Flow rate: max. 600 m³/h Head: max. 98 m Permissible operating pressure: up to 16 bar Temperature: -50 °C to +140 °C Viscosity: up to 200 mm²/s
